    The functions listed below are those that represent the majority of the time spent working in this position. Management may assign additional functions related to the type of work of the position as necessary. Cleans the interior of County buildings which includes vacuuming floors, cleaning bathrooms, emptying trashcans, cleaning office and conference rooms, mopping floors, washing windows, cleaning jail cells and cleaning doors and walls. Utilizes various equipment and machinery such as buffer, vacuum cleaner and various cleaning supplies and chemicals. Performs numerous tasks and duties to maintain the floors such as sweeping, mopping, scrubbing, vacuuming, cleaning carpets, buffing, waxing, etc. Empties garbage and trash containers on a regular basis; keeps containers clean and sanitary. Maintains the cleanliness of walls, windows, and furniture as needed by washing, dusting, waxing, or buffing. Maintains the restrooms in a clean and sanitary manner in order to promote hygiene; replaces soap, toilet tissue, paper towels, etc. as necessary. Communicates verbal and written information with immediate supervisor and the public in order to provide assistance, receiving instructions, exchange information, and complete daily job-related activities. Utilizes a variety of tools and equipment in the performance of job including brooms, mops, cleaners, buffers, keys, disinfectants, insecticides, vacuums, carpet cleaners, scrubbers, etc. Performs related work as required. Minimum Education and Experience Requirements: Requires a high school diploma or GED equivalent with six (6) months of experience in custodial or maintenance duties or any equivalent combination of education, training, and experience. Physical Demands: Performs light to medium work that involves walking or standing virtually all of the time and also involves exerting between 20 and 50 pounds of force on a regular and recurring basis or skill, adeptness and speed in the use of the fingers, hands or limbs on repetitive operation of mechanical or electronic office or shop machines or tools within moderate tolerances or limits of accuracy. Unavoidable Hazards (Work Environment): None. Special Certifications and Licenses: Must possess and maintain a valid state driver's license with an acceptable driving history.     This shift can begin between 11:00 a.m. and noon and end between 7:00 p.m. and 8:00 p.m., depending on campus assignment. Job Title: Custodian Reports to: Custodial Supervisor Dept./School: Assigned Campus(es) Exemption Status: Non-Exempt / 250 Days Salary calculations will be commensurate with job experience. Primary Purpose: Follow routine cleaning and maintenance procedures to maintain a high standard of safety, cleanliness, and efficiency of building operations and grounds. Qualifications: Education/Certification: None specified Special Knowledge/Skills/Abilities: Ability to read and understand instructions for cleaning, maintenance, and safety procedures Knowledge of minor repair techniques and building and grounds maintenance Ability to operate cleaning equipment and lift heavy equipment Ability to properly handle cleaning supplies Experience: None Major Responsibilities and Duties: Cleaning 1. Develop and maintain a cleaning schedule that will include cleaning of floors, chalkboards, wastebaskets, windows, furniture, equipment, and restrooms. 2. Keep school building and grounds, including sidewalks, driveways, parking lots, and play areas neat and clean. 3. Comply with local laws and procedures for storage and disposal of trash. 4. Maintain an inventory of cleaning supplies and equipment and order additional supplies as needed. Maintenance and Repair 5. Maintain a program of preventive maintenance to ensure the comfort, health, and safety of students and staff. 6. Regulate heat, ventilation, and air conditioning systems to provide appropriate temperatures and ensure economical usage of fuel, water, and electricity. 7. Make minor building repairs as needed and report major repair needs to principal. 8. Move furniture or equipment within building as directed by principal. Safety 9. Assume responsibility for opening and closing building each school day. 10. Establish procedure for locking, checking, and safeguarding facilities. 11. Check daily to ensure that all exit doors are open and all panic bolts are working properly during hours of building occupancy. 12. Inspect machines and equipment for safety and efficiency. 13. Operate tools and equipment according to established safety procedures. 14. Follow established safety procedures and techniques to perform job duties including lifting, climbing, etc. 15. Correct unsafe conditions in work area and report any conditions that are not correctable to supervisor immediately. 16.Trained in crossing guard duties and will be in the rotation to be either a morning or afternoon crossing guard. Supervisory Responsibilities: None Mental Demands/Physical Demands/Environmental Factors: Tools/Equipment Used: Buffer, stripper, wet and dry vacuum cleaner, electric drill, shampooer, lawn mower, edger, and weed eater. Motion: Strenuous walking, standing, and/or climbing. Lifting: Heavy lifting and carrying up to sixty pounds. Environment: Work outside and inside; exposure to hot and cold temperatures; exposure to dust, toxic chemicals, and materials; slippery or uneven walking surfaces; work on ladders. Mental Demands: Work with frequent interruptions; maintain emotional control under stress. How much does a custodian earn in Temple, TX?

The average custodian in Temple, TX earns between $17,000 and $30,000 annually. This compares to the national average custodian range of $23,000 to $39,000.

Average custodian salary in Temple, TX

$23,000
